Architecture of Observation Towers

It seems to be human nature to enjoy a view, getting the higher ground and taking in our surroundings has become a significant aspect of architecture across the world. Observation towers which allow visitors to climb and observe their surroundings, provide a chance to take in the beauty of the land while at the same time adding something unique and impressive to the landscape.

How to Find a Psychotherapist Near Me

Psychotherapy can help with various problems, including depression, anxiety relationships, grief, stress, addiction to drugs and bedwetting in children. Professionals who are licensed to practice this treatment include psychologists and psychiatrists. Counselors and Social Workers are also licensed to provide therapy, but they often have a distinct style.

Start by finding a therapist that will meet your needs and accepts your insurance coverage. Ask your family or friends as well as your medical doctor for suggestions.

Find a psychiatrist or a Psychologist.

Many people seek out therapy to help deal with issues such as anxiety, depression, the loss of a loved-one or relationship issues or stress at work. These problems can have an enormous impact on the level of living and could be difficult to manage without professional assistance. A psychotherapist can provide the tools and support required to conquer these issues and lead a healthier and happier life.

There are many factors to take into consideration when selecting a mental health practitioner such as their education and experience. Finding someone with whom you can discuss your private and confidential information is the most crucial aspect. It is essential to find a doctor who shares your goals and treatment philosophy.

iampsychiatry-logo-wide.pngAsking your family and friends who have gone to therapy for themselves can be helpful in determining the kind of therapist will best meet your requirements. You can also use an online locator to locate a Therapist. After narrowing your choices down, schedule initial appointments with the therapists you've put on your short list. This will allow you to gain an understanding of each therapist, their availability and pricing before making your final decision.

A psychiatrist is a medical doctor who has completed four years of medical school and three or more years in residency training, and is specialized in the diagnosis and treatment of mental disorders. Psychiatrists can prescribe medication in addition to offering psychotherapy.

A psychologist, on the other hand is a mental health professional with an advanced master's degree or higher in psychology. They are able to provide psychotherapy and work with patients of all ages to help them manage psychological, cognitive and behavioral issues. They typically have less extensive testing capabilities than psychiatrists, and can charge lower fees for their services.

A Licensed Marriage and Family Therapist (LMFT) is a therapist with at least a master's degree who can work with individuals and couples to treat a range of mental health issues, like relationship issues, eating disorders and grief and loss. Unlike psychiatrists and psychologists, LMFTs are not trained to prescribe or administer medications.

Search Online

Ask family and friends who have attended therapy in the past for suggestions. They can recommend therapy providers based on your requirements and goals. You can also locate the therapist you need through an online database such as Psychology Today, which lists credentialed professionals based on zip code. It also allows you to filter them by specialization area and insurance coverage, among other. You can also check with non-profit organizations, schools and faith-based communities that typically have therapists on their list of psychiatrists near me of referrals.

Pena advised that when selecting a therapist to choose, it is important to ensure that they are employing evidence-based methods. This means they employ methods that have been proven to be efficient and tested for example, such as cognitive behavior therapy or inter-personal therapy. It is also important to find a therapist that is familiar with your specific mental health problem or issue such as anxiety, depression or bedwetting among children.

Pena said that you can also search for a therapist through national or regional networks and associations or helplines. Many organizations that are connected to work, such as unions, offer resources through membership programs connecting employees to counselors who can assist with mental health concerns or other issues.

Another option is to see whether your employer has employee assistance programs (EAPs) that provide over-the-phone or in-person counseling services at no cost. These EAPs offer an array of psychologists or licensed counselors in your area and can help you with a wide range of emotional issues, from marital problems to post-traumatic disorder and substance abuse issues.

It's crucial to find a therapist that will fit into your routine and lifestyle, Pena said. When you're making your final selection be sure to consider whether they have weekend or evening hours and how long they typically have appointments. It's also important to determine if they accept your insurance or if they offer the services of telehealth for those who live in remote areas.

If you're on a budget then you may want to find low-cost options for psychotherapy through community mental health clinics or visiting graduate school campuses that provide services at a lower price, he said. Some of these programs hire therapist interns in training who are overseen by licensed professionals.
